加载元数据时如何设置繁忙状态

2020-09-24 04:52发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)亲爱的 我正在开发一个使用fl...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


亲爱的

我正在开发一个使用flexColumnLayout的主从应用程序。 我要根据指南(https://ux.wdf.sap.corp/fiori-design-web/busy-handling/)添加忙处理:在加载元数据时将页面设置为忙,而在加载后不忙。 我不知道在哪个函数中调用setBusy()。 你有什么主意吗?

非常感谢您:)

最好的问候

Y

7条回答
土豆飞人
2020-09-24 05:17

您好,我认为您刚刚共享的链接仅在您的Intranet上可用;)

所以,让我们从头开始。 每个扩展sap.ui.core.Control的控件(可能是控件和自定义控件的99%;)都将允许您处理繁忙状态。

如果需要,可以按以下方式处理页面的全局繁忙状态:

显示繁忙指示器

 sap.ui.core.BusyIndi​​cator.show(<毫秒数>); 

隐藏忙碌指示器

 sap.ui.core.BusyIndi​​cator.hide(); 

通常,知道何时必须显示/隐藏繁忙指示器的经验法则是:

  • 在每个oDataModel读取/bindItems之前显示它
  • 在成功/错误回叫时将其隐藏

一周热门 更多>